CSSLP Certified Secure Software Lifecycle Professional Exam details:

  • Exam Name : ISC2 Certified Secure Software Lifecycle Professional (CSSLP)

  • Exam code: CSSLP

  • Exam voucher cost: $599 (USD)

  • Exam languages:

  • Exam format: Multiple-choice, multiple-answer

  • Number of questions: 125

  • Length of exam: 180 minutes

  • Passing grade: 700/1000


CSSLP Certified Secure Software Lifecycle Professional Exam domains:

  • Domain 1- Secure Software Concepts

    Firstly, this domain covers the Core Concepts. It includes confidentiality ,Integrity , Availability, Authentication , Authorization Accountability and Nonrepudiation. Further it also covers the Security Design Principles. These are Least privilege, Separation of duties, economy of mechanism and Complete mediation.


  • Domain 2-Secure Software Requirements

    It includes the concepts to Define Software Security Requirements, Identify and Analyze Compliance Requirements, Identify and Analyze Data Classification Requirements and Privacy Requirement. Also, Develop Misuse and Abuse Cases, Develop Security Requirement Traceability Matrix (STRM) and Ensure Security Requirements Flow Down to Suppliers/Providers.


  • Domain 3- Secure Software Architecture and Design

    Thirdly, this domain is much focused on the topics to Perform Threat Modeling, Define the Security Architecture, Performing Secure Interface Design and Performing Architectural Risk Assessment. Also, Model (Non-Functional) Security Properties and Constraints and Model and Classify Data. Moreover, Evaluate and Select Reusable Secure Design, Perform Security Architecture and Design Review, Define Secure Operational Architecture and Use Secure Architecture and Design Principles, Patterns, and Tools


  • Domain 4- Secure Software Implementation

    Also, this domain covers the concepts to Adhere to Relevant Secure Coding Practices, Analyze Code for Security Risks, Implement Security Controls and Address Security Risks. Also, Securely Reuse Third-Party Code or Libraries, Securely Integrate Components and Apply Security During the Build Process


  • Domain 5- Secure Software Testing

    Further, this domain aims to Develop Security Test Cases, Develop Security Testing Strategy and Plan. Verify and Validate Documentation, Identify Undocumented Functionality and Analyze Security Implications of Test Results. Also, Classify and Track Security Errors, Secure Test Data and Perform Verification and Validation Testing.


  • Domain 6- Secure Lifecycle Management

    Subsequently, this domain is much focused on the Secure Configuration and Version Control, Define Strategy and Roadmap, Manage Security Within a Software Development Methodology, Identify Security Standards and Frameworks and Define and Develop Security Documentation. Moreover, Develop Security Metrics, Decommission Software, Report Security Status and Incorporate Integrated Risk Management. Also, Promote Security Culture in Software Development. Further, Implement Continuous Improvement.


  • Domain 7: Secure Software Deployment, Operations, Maintenance

    Moreover, this domain is focused on Perform Operational Risk Analysis, Release Software Securely, Securely Store and Manage Security Data. Also, Ensure Secure Installation, Perform Post-Deployment Security Testing, and Obtain Security Approval to Operate. Further, Perform Information Security Continuous Monitoring, Support Incident Response, and Perform Patch Management. Additionally, Perform Vulnerability Management, Runtime Protection, Support Continuity of Operations and 3 Integrate Service Level Objectives (SLO) and Service Level Agreements (SLA).


  • Domain 8: Secure Software Supply Chain

    Lastly, this domain includes Implement Software Supply Chain Risk Management, Analyze Security of Third-Party Software and Verify Pedigree and Provenance. Also, Ensure Supplier Security Requirements in the Acquisition Process and Support contractual requirements
